Residential Fumigation in San Antonio, TX
Residential fumigation services involve the controlled application of pest control treatments to eliminate or eradicate infestations within homes and other residential properties. These services are commonly requested for issues such as bed bugs, termites, cockroaches, or other persistent pests that are difficult to manage with standard methods. Projects typically include treating entire structures, including walls, attics, crawl spaces, and other hidden areas where pests may hide. Homeowners often seek information on preparation requirements, treatment procedures, and any necessary post-treatment steps to ensure the effectiveness of the fumigation process.
Property owners should understand that fumigation is a comprehensive approach designed to thoroughly eliminate pests from residential spaces. Before requesting this service, it is important to know if the property needs to be vacated during treatment, what items may need to be removed or covered, and any safety precautions to consider afterward. Clarifying these details can help ensure a smooth process and successful pest eradication, providing peace of mind that the property will be pest-free following treatment.

Residential Fumigation Questions
What pests can residential fumigation eliminate? Fumigation effectively targets pests such as termites, bed bugs, fleas, and cockroaches in residential properties.
How should homeowners prepare for fumigation? Preparation includes removing food, personal items, and opening interior cabinets to ensure safe and effective treatment.
Is fumigation safe for my household and pets? Fumigation is performed with safety precautions in place to protect residents and pets during and after the process.
How often is residential fumigation recommended? The frequency depends on pest infestation levels and property conditions; a professional assessment can determine the best schedule.
